湖北文理學(xué)院 畢業(yè)論文(設(shè)計)報告紙 湖北文理學(xué)院 畢業(yè)設(shè)計 (論文 )正文 題 目 基于 Pro/E 的挖掘機的設(shè)計與運動仿真 專 業(yè) 機械設(shè)計制造及其自動化 班 級 機制 0812 班 姓 名 倪宗道 學(xué) 號 08116225 指導(dǎo)教師 張 俊 教授 2021 年 5 月 16 日 湖 北文理學(xué)院 畢業(yè)論文(設(shè)計)報告紙 基于 Pro/E 的挖掘機的設(shè)計與運動仿真 摘要: 挖掘機廣泛應(yīng)用于工程機械中,隨著科學(xué)技術(shù)和制造業(yè)的發(fā)展 ,計算機輔助設(shè)計技術(shù)越來越廣泛地應(yīng)用在各個設(shè)計領(lǐng)域,為了縮短產(chǎn)品的設(shè)計周期、提高設(shè)計質(zhì)量、降低設(shè)計成本 ,滿足投資者和產(chǎn)品更新?lián)Q代的需要。根據(jù)挖掘機的工作原理和結(jié)構(gòu)特點,利用三維建模軟件 Pro/Engineer 建立了挖掘機各零件的三維模型,并在此基礎(chǔ)上進行零件的裝配、干涉檢查、運動仿真分析等高級計算機輔助設(shè)計工作,將復(fù)雜的挖掘機形象地展現(xiàn)在用戶面前,使設(shè)計者在設(shè)計階段就能清楚地見到產(chǎn)品的最終結(jié)果,及時發(fā)現(xiàn)設(shè)計問題,既減輕了工作量又節(jié)省了資金,為新產(chǎn)品的開發(fā)奠定了基礎(chǔ),有助于增強企業(yè)的產(chǎn)品開發(fā)能力。 關(guān)鍵詞 : 挖掘機;虛擬裝配;三維建模; Pro/E;運動 仿真 湖 北文理學(xué)院 畢業(yè)論文(設(shè)計)報告紙 Structural Design and Motion Simulation of the Excavator Based on Pro / E Abstract: With the development of science and technology and manufacturing excavators are widely used in construction machinery, puteraided design technology bees more widely used in various design fields, in order to shorten the design cycle, improve design quality, reduce design costs, meet the needs of investors and product replacement.
